        Promoter Analysis of Bombyx mori Nucleopolyhedrovirus Ubiquitin Gene

        Xu’ai Lin,Yin Chen,Yongzhu Yi,Jie Yan,Zhifang Zhang 한국미생물학회 2008 The journal of microbiology Vol.46 No.4

        The aim of this study was to analyze the characteristics of Bombyx mori nucleopolyhedrovirus (BmNPV) ubiquitin gene promoter and the effects of conserved motifs, such as TAAG, TATA, and CAAT, along with baculovirus enhancer homologous region 3 (hr3), on promoter activity. Ubiquitin gene of BmNPV was expressed during the late phase of virus infection. In the presence of viral factors, significant reduction of promoter activity was observed by deletion of -382 to -124 bp upstream of ATG. The fragment between -187 and -383 bp upstream of ATG, including distal TAAG, CAAT motif, and TATA box, could also drive expression of the reporter gene. The mutation of cis-elements TATA boxes and TAAG motifs significantly decreased the promoter’s activity, while CAAT mutations enhanced promoter activity by 2- or 3-fold, as compared with the native promoter. In the presence of BmNPV, hr3, both located downstream of the reporter gene of the same vector, and separate vector, could significantly enhance transcription activity of ubiquitin promoter as compared to the control. We concluded that BmNPV ubiquitin gene might be regulated by dual sets of promoter elements, where TAAG and TATA box may positively regulate the expression of ubiquitin, while CAAT motif functions as a negative regulator. Viral factor(s) play an important role in the co-activation of hr3 and promoter.

        Cloning, Expression, and Functional Characterization of the Dunaliella salina 5-enolpyruvylshikimate-3-phosphate Synthase Gene in Escherichia coli

        Yi, Yi,Qiao, Dairong,Bai, Linhan,Xu, Hui,Li, Ya,Wang, Xiaolin,Cao, Yi The Microbiological Society of Korea 2007 The journal of microbiology Vol.45 No.2

        5-enolpyruvylshikimate-3-phosphate synthase (EPSP synthase, EC 2.5.1.19) is the sixth enzyme in the shikimate pathway which is essential for the synthesis of aromatic amino acids and many secondary metabolites. The enzyme is widely involved in glyphosate tolerant transgenic plants because it is the primary target of the nonselective herbicide glyphosate. In this study, the Dunaliella salina EPSP synthase gene was cloned by RT-PCR approach. It contains an open reading frame encoding a protein of 514 amino acids with a calculated molecular weight of 54.6 KDa. The derived amino acid sequence showed high homology with other EPSP synthases. The Dunaliella salina EPSP synthase gene was expressed in Escherichia coli and the recombinant EPSP synthase were identified by functional complementation assay.

        Comparative Analysis of the Genomes of Bombyx mandarina and Bombyx mori Nucleopolyhedroviruses

        Yi-Peng Xu,Zheng-Pei Ye,Chang-Ying Niu,Yan-Yuan Bao,Wen-Bing Wang,Wei-De Shen,Chuan-Xi Zhang 한국미생물학회 2010 The journal of microbiology Vol.48 No.1

        The Bombyx mandarina nucleopolyhedrovirus (BomaNPV) S1 strain can infect the silkworm, Bombyx mori,but is significantly less virulent than B. mori nucleopolyhedrovirus (BmNPV) T3 strain. The complete nucleotide sequence of the S1 strain of BomaNPV was determined and compared with the BmNPV T3 strain. The circular, double stranded DNA genome of the S1 strain was 126,770 nucleotides long (GenBank accession no. FJ882854), with a G+C content of 40.23%. The genome contained 133 potential ORFs. Most of the putative proteins were more than 96% identical to homologs in the BmNPV T3 strain, except for bro-a, lef-12,bro-c, and bro-d. Compared with the BmNPV T3 strain, however, this genome did not encode the bro-b and bro-e genes. In addition, hr1 lacked two repeat units, while hr2L, hr2R, hr3, hr4L, hr4R, and hr5 were similar to the corresponding hrs in the T3 strain. The sequence strongly suggested that BomaNPV and BmNPV are variants with each other, and supported the idea that baculovirus strain heterogeneity may often be caused by variation in the hrs and bro genes.

        A Comparison of Transradial and Transfemoral Percutaneous Coronary Intervention in Chinese Women Based on a Propensity Score Analysis

        Yi Xu,Chen Jin,Shubin Qiao,Yongjian Wu,Hongbing Yan,Kefei Dou,Bo Xu,Jingang Yang,Yuejin Yang 대한심장학회 2018 Korean Circulation Journal Vol.48 No.8

        Background and Objectives: Over the past decades, transradial approach for percutaneous coronary intervention (PCI) has been increasingly adopted in clinical practice. Women represent a large population who will possibly benefit from PCI, but they are often under-represented in clinical studies. Therefore, the role of TRI in women remains to be further defined. This study sought to compare safety and efficacy for transradial intervention (TRI) and transfemoral intervention (TFI) in women undergoing PCI in China. Methods: The study population consisted of 5,067 women undergoing PCI at Fuwai Hospital, Beijing, China between 2006 and 2011 (TRI: n=4,105, TFI: n=962). Incidence rates of clinical outcomes during hospitalization and at 1-year follow-up were compared between TRI and TFI. In order to minimize potential biases, a 1:1 propensity score matching (PSM) was performed. A total of 899 pairs were matched. Results: Baseline and procedural characteristics were well-balanced between TRI and TFI groups after controlling for confounders using PSM. TRI was associated with reduced major post-PCI bleeding (odds ratio [OR], 0.64; 95% confidence interval [CI], 0.54–0.76; p<0.001) and access site complications (OR, 0.67; 95% CI, 0.61–0.74; p<0.001) after PSM. There was no statistical differences in the incidence rates of major adverse cardiac events (a composite of cardiac death, myocardial infarction, and target vessel revascularization) both during hospitalization and at 1-year follow-up (p>0.05). Conclusions: In this propensity score-based analysis of TRI versus TFI in Chinese women, TRI showed advantages of safety and feasibility over TFI. A wider adoption of TRI in women has the potential to improve outcomes in treatment of coronary artery diseases.

        十八世紀朝淸文士筆談內容考述

        ( Yi Xu ),( Li Chen ) 한국외국어대학교 중국연구소 2014 中國硏究 Vol.60 No.-

        The 18th century is a period when Qing and Choson literati communicate frequently with a variety of communicating forms such as conversations by writing, the exchange of poetry, reciprocating letters, asking for providing preface and postscript, literary criticism as well as giving books as presents, among which the conversations by writing is the most popular way of interaction. According to statistical study by the author, at least 193 detailed conversations by writing happened in the 18th century were recorded in the extant Yeonhaeng Rok, one of Chinese and Korean ancient scriptures. Its contents mainly covered ten aspects, in which some in-depth exchange was recorded. Therefore, these materials are of great literature value. Regarding to the communication of etiquette system and custom, Qing people`s comments on Choson ambassadors` clothing and inturn Choson views of binding feet of Qing women are always the key points. Besides, it also includes the communication of imperial examination system in Qing Dynasty and Ancient Korea;the discussion about academy and literary between Qing and Choson scholars; Choson literati` concerns with religion; Choson literati` focus on the Ming historical events, Qing political and agricultural situation as well associal development; Choson literati` acquaintance with compilation of books in Qing Dynasty, for example "The Imperial Collection of Four Treasures";the exchange of banned books in Qing Dynasty between Qing and Choson literati; Choson scholars` care for the landscape, geography of China and places of interest in China. Qing people also pay attention to Choson in many regards, for instance, landscape and geographical situation, scene style and feature views, ancient authors and their works, history, etiquette, custom, education, languageetc. It is obvious to find the diversity of their conversation topics. And these topics are closely associated with the culture, custom, history and the focus on Confucianism of Qing Dynasty and Choson. It should also be emphasized that no matter how abundant the conversations are, the key point is always related to concerns of Choson literati when visiting Qing Dynasty and their own scholar traits.

        The Effects of Allitridin on the Expression of Transcription Factors T-bet and GATA-3 in Mice Infected by Murine Cytomegalovirus

        Xu Yi,Fang Feng,Zhidan Xiang,Li Ge 한국식품영양과학회 2005 Journal of medicinal food Vol.8 No.3

        This study was designed to investigate the effects of allitridin on the expression of transcription factors T-betand GATA-3 in mice infected by murine cytomegalovirus (MCMV). A BALB/c mouse model system of MCMV infectionwas established. Twenty mice were allocated randomly into an allitridin-treated group (n . 10) and a placebo control group(n . 10). The same dose (25 mg/kg/day) and regimen of allitridin were used in the treated group in the 24 hours after virusinfection; the same volume of saline solution was injected in placebo control mice. In an additional blank control group (n .10), the same volume of saline solution was injected. The expression levels of the transcription factors T-bet and GATA-3were measured by reverse transcriptionpolymerase chain reaction. The expression levels of the T helper (Th) 1 cytokine in-terferon-. (IFN-.) and the Th2 cytokine interleukin (IL)-10 in supernatant of spleen cell culture were measured by enzyme-linked immunosorbent assay. MCMV infection markedly down-modulated the expression of IFN-. and T-bet and significantlyup-modulated the expression of IL-10 and GATA-3. Allitridin induced significantly (P. .01) increased expression of thetranscription factor T-bet and the Th1 cytokine IFN-. and markedly (P. .01) decreased expression of the transcription fac-tor GATA-3 and the Th2 cytokine IL-10. Thus MCMV infection could lead to disequilibrium of Th1/Th2 cytokine expres-sion: The level of the Th1 cytokine IFN- was decreased significantly, and Th2 cytokine IL-10 was overexpressed markedly.Allitridin could up-regulate the expression of T-bet and IFN-. and inhibit the expression of GATA-3 and IL-10 in MCMV-infected mice, indicating a Th1 dominant state, which should enhance the specific cellular immune reactions against cy-tomegalovirus (CMV) and be helpful for clearance of CMV from the host.

        朝鮮使者眼中的淸代戱曲

        ( Yi Xu ) 연민학회 2010 연민학지 Vol.14 No.-

        본고는 조선시기 『燕行錄』중의 희곡 관련 자료를 연구대상으로 하여, 이국자의 시각으로 본 청대 희곡의 연극 활동 상황을 고찰하여 본다. 본고는 우선 『燕行錄』중에 청대 희곡의 연출 환경에 대한 묘사를 검토 분석하고, 그 다음 희곡 연출 복식에 대한 조선 사신들의 관심에 대해 논술하고, 마지막으로 『燕行錄』에 기록된 희곡 극목에 근거하여 청대 민간 희곡과 궁정 희곡의 분야를 서술해보려고 한다. 이런 보기드문 희곡 자료에 대한 정리를 통해 청대 희곡 연구의 시야를 넓혀보려고 한다. The research object of this paper is the Chinese Opera materials that are contained in YanXingLu (Travelogues of Korean Envoys to China). The activities of the Chinese opera are depicted through the perspective of Li Dynasty`s scholars. Firstly, I will analyze the environment of the performance recorded by the Korean envoys. Secondly, I will explain the reason that Korean scholars pay attention to the costume of the Chinese Opera. Finally, I will illustrate the differences between the folk drama and the palace opera. We could expand our research sight on the Qing Dynasty Opera by analyzing these ancient art works.

      • Framing advocacy event: Comparing news coverage and Facebook comments of the Belt and Road Forum in Pakistan and the USA

        Xu, Yi World Association for Triple Helix and Future Stra 2021 Journal of Contemporary Eastern Asia Vol.20 No.1

        With regard to the recent developments in public diplomacy, the increasing fusion of strategic communication appears necessary. China engages in public diplomacy with a strategic purpose to shape its national image abroad. Hosting diplomatic advocacy event is regarded as an instrument with expectations to present reliable and responsible image and promote international collaborations. The present research focuses on the Belt and Road Forum (BRF) in May 2017 with the objective to analyze its outcomes and influence on the international news agenda, news frames, and foreign citizens' comments online. The quantitative content analyses are used to compare the media reports (N=364) and Facebook users' comments on the selected news (N=957) between the US and Pakistan. Results reveal that Pakistani media provided more diverse frames and attributed more positive evaluations to the BRF than the US media. However, Facebook comments expressed more unfavorable opinions toward the BRF and China's image with rare differences between two countries. In conclusion, the BRF has served as an eye-catching advocacy of Chinese foreign policy, as it influenced the news agenda in two selected countries. However, news frames vary due to the differences in media system and the involvement in the BRF. China's public diplomacy practices follow a traditional top-down communication which needs meticulous subdivision of target stakeholders, delicate messaging strategies, and integrated tactics.

        Influence of Hybrid Ratios on Shape Memory Properties of Basalt/Carbon Fiber Hybrid Composites with Graphene Oxide Prepared by VIHPS

        Yi Xu,Yuqin Ma,Yu Yang,Gangfeng Wang,Wei Xu,Fei Li,Haiyin Guo,Yatao Li 한국섬유공학회 2023 Fibers and polymers Vol.24 No.8

        A study on the shape memory properties of 6 layers bi-directional basalt fiber/carbon fiber hybrid composites with graphene oxide (GO) was presented in this paper. The hybrid composites were prepared by the vacuum infiltration hot pressing system (VIHPS). The macroscopic appearance of these composites was desirable, and their microstructure was satisfactory. According to the test results, with the content of basalt fiber decreased, the shape fixation ratio decreased, while the shape recovery ratio and shape recovery force all increased. The basalt fiber composite with 6 layers basalt fiber (B6) had a maximum shape fixation ratio of 94.94%, a minimum shape recovery ratio of 85.52%, and a minimum recovery force of 1.36 N. Compared with B6, the shape fixation ratio of the carbon fiber composite with 6 layers carbon fiber (C6) decreased by 10.43%, which was 84.51%. The shape recovery ratio and shape recovery force were increased by 9.60% and 3.31 times, and their values were 95.12% and 5.86 N, respectively. In addition, according to the temperature-recovery force curves, it was found that the seven groups of composites all reached their maximum shape recovery force when the temperature was about 110 °C. When the temperature was between 50 °C and 80 °C, the recovery force of the composite increased greatly, and then, the recovery force increased slightly. However, when the temperature was above the glass transition temperature (Tg), the recovery force gradually decreased.

        Enhanced Photocatalytic Performance of Heterojunction BiOI/BiOIO3 Nanocomposites Under Simulated Solar Light

        Yi Ling Qi,Xu Chun Song,Yi Fan Zheng 성균관대학교(자연과학캠퍼스) 성균나노과학기술원 2017 NANO Vol.12 No.3

        Novel heterostructure BiOI/BiOIO3 nanocomposites were successfully prepared through a facile deposition method at room temperature. BiOIO3 is a noncentrosymmetric compound that has an internal self-built electric field. BiOI was applied as a visible light absorber to sensitize semiconductors owing to its smallest bandgap. The coupling between BiOIO3 and BiOI can combine their advantages and improve photocatalytic properties. Compared with the single BiOI and BiOIO3, the heterostructure BiOI/BiOIO3 nanocomposites displayed a significantly enhanced photocatalytic activity for the Rhodamine B (RhB) degradation. The enhanced photocatalytic performance is deduced closely related to the formation of BiOI/BiOIO3 heterojunction interface whose presence is regarded to be a favorable factor for the transfer and separation of the photogenerated electrons and holes.
